[TPIN] mute cork alternatives/repairs?

Go to your local hobby store and buy cork track-bedding material. It comes 
in various width strips (based on the width of various size model train 
tracks) and lengths of about two feet. It's dirt cheap (maybe 30 cents a 
length) and perfect for the job. You can wrap it around a harmon or cut 
pieces for a straight/cup. For thicker pieces just layer it using contact 
cement.
